Notes |
Additional information (en): This feature has an elongated shape. Minimum depth (m): 1586. Maximum depth (m): 4161. Total relief (m): 2575. Dimension/size: 3 km x 70 km. |
|
GEBCO: associated meeting, proposer and year of proposal (en): Associated meeting: SCUFN-36. Proposer: Japanese Committee on Undersea Feature Names (JCUFN). History: 2023. |
|
GEBCO: discoverer and year of discovery (en): Discoverer: Japanese survey vessel "Takuyo". Year of discovery: 1988. History: Named from its geographical location as the feature is part of a tectonic element known as “Sofu-gan Tectonic Line”.(“Kita” means “north” in Japanese). |
